Mumbai, May 31 (KNN) Messe Muenchen India is currently hosting the 9th edition of Air Cargo India 2022 from May 31 to June 22 in Mumbai focusing on exclusively on the pharma, e-commerce, drones, and technology sectors.
It is an exhibition-cum-conference for the air cargo industry in India which will take place at Grand Hyatt.
Over the years, air cargo India has earned a reputation for tapping the pulse of this highly dynamic industry and creating the right platform for business leaders, stakeholders, and innovators to exchange ideas and opportunities as well as global perspectives and future developments.
Bhupinder Singh, CEO, Messe Muenchen India said, “The air cargo industry in India has shown tremendous resilience, spirit of innovation, and technology adoption during the pandemic period. As the industry recalibrates for post-pandemic realities and growth opportunities, air cargo India 2022 will offer the ideal platform to share the learnings, expand networks, and align business interests.”
Our well-curated conferences will elaborate on the evolving needs of pharma shipments and the latest trends in ecommerce cargo, he said.
The conference will also host the STAT Times Awards night which will felicitate the industry leaders who have outperformed despite all odds.
“We hope everyone in the air cargo business in India visits us and receives maximum value for their time at air cargo India 2022,” added Singh. (KNN Bureau)
